none
Que es más rápido (Consulta SQL ó Archivo HTML) RRS feed

  • Pregunta

  • Un saludo a todos...

    Tengo una duda, tengo mi aplicación en asp.net y los contenidos de la web los tengo guardados en una base de datos.

    Mismos que se muestran en la página al hacer la consulta.

    Ejem:

    Contenido.aspx?ID=60

    Donde el ID es la clave del registro en la base de datos que contienen código en HTML y se muestra en la página.

     

    Quiero saber que es mas recomendable y más rápido.

    Mostrar contenidos directo de la base de datos atravez de una consulta ó desde un archivo en HTML.

     

    Tomando en cuenta que ambos puedan contener la misma información.

     

    ¿como puedo medir la velocidad de carga de cada uno?

     

    saludos

     

    jueves, 10 de enero de 2008 6:17

Todas las respuestas

  • Hola,

     

    a ver si te he entedido bien...

     

    preguntas: ¿que va mas rapido hacer una consulta a base de datos para sacar unos datos y pintarlos en pantalla o tener los datos directamente escritos en un html?

     

    hombre... obviamente tenernos escritos a pelo en el html va mas rapido... mas que nada porque te ahorras... la conexion a base de datos y la ejecucion del asp, ya que el html se sirve directamente sin que el servidor lo trate directamente.

     

    eso si... el asp te permite actualizacion dinamica de continidos en las paginas... mientras que el html... si lo quieres cambiar te lo tiene que picar a mano.

     

    un saludo.

    jueves, 10 de enero de 2008 7:28
    Moderador
  • Como dice Javier, si bien un archito html no hace el trabajo que una aspx, imagino que tener que crear miles de archivos html?

    de ahi donde la mayoría use tecnologias de servidor ASp.NET,  Php, JSP, o XYP... ahora una tecnologia de servidor no tarde mucho en servir una página...salvo que tengas querys marcianos...

    Saludos,
    jueves, 10 de enero de 2008 14:13
  • Bien, la idea era hacer una menejador de contenidos para mi web, asi poder actualizarla desde cualquier parte en línea.

    Hasta ahora los contenidos los guardaba en la base de datos y las páginas se mostraban directamente haciendo una consulta a la BD.

     

    Entonces, Es más recomendable que al guardar el contenido de mi editor (WYSIWYG HTML), haga dos cosas:

    1.- Guardar en la base de datos

    2.- Generar un archivo .html

     

    El primero me permitira editar el contenido cuando quiera.

    El segundo sera el archivo que se cargara dinámicamente en mi web. (esto la hara trabajar más rápido)

     

    Gracias, Saludos

    jueves, 10 de enero de 2008 15:42